Burstow - TfL have seen the light12.00.00am BST (GMT +0100) Tue 21st Oct 2008 Paul Burstow, MP for Sutton and Cheam, has welcomed news that TfL have abandoned their plan to remove Cheam's heritage lampposts. Commenting on the news Paul said: 'I'm glad that TfL have abandoned their plan and are now going to work with Sutton Council to upgrade the existing lampposts. 'Local pressure has helped them see sense and now we can look forward to better lighting for Cheam without any damage being done to the unique character of the village. 'I will, of course, be keeping up the pressure on TfL to ensure that that they respect the conservation status of the village.' ENDS Notes to Editors: Representatives from TfL and the local council will met yesterday (20th October 2008) to discuss proposals to enhance the existing heritage lighting.
